Erick Thohir Denies Removing PLN’s Managing Director Due to German StreetScooter Acquisition

TEMPO.CO, Jakarta -Minister of State-Owned Enterprises Erick Thohir has removed Zulkifli Zaini from his position as president director of PT Perusahaan Listrik Negara (Persero) or President Director of PLN. Erick denied that Zulkifli was fired because he was said to have not approved the acquisition of an electric car from Germany’s StreetScooter GmbH in the Odin Project.

Erick also denied that Zulkifli was fired because he was threatened by a member of the DPR’s Energy Commission, Muhammad Nasir. Nasir at that time asked Zulkifli to be removed due to the problem of purchasing coal by PLN.

“All is well, it’s nothing,” said Erick Thohir when met at Sarinah, Central Jakarta, Wednesday, December 8, 2021

Previously, Zulkifli’s removal was carried out at the General Meeting of Shareholders or PLN’s GMS on December 6, 2021. Zulkifli was then replaced by his deputy, Darmawan Prasodjo.

The StreetScooter issue was revealed in a report from Tempo Magazine, November 20, 2021 edition, entitled “The Minister’s Odin Project”. StreetScooter is a subsidiary of Duetsche Post AG from Germany, or better known as Deutsche Post DHL Group.

The acquisition is planned to be carried out by Indonesia Battery Corporation (IBC). This is a joint venture of PT Indonesia Asahan Aluminum aka Mind Id, PT Pertamina (Persero), PLN, and PT Aneka Tambang Tbk.

However, a Tempo source said that Mind Id, under Orias President Director Petrus Moedak, had been sacked first and PLN under Zulkifli Zaini had not yet agreed to the Odin Project. This report states that an official who is familiar with the planned transaction said that the basis for the rejection of the old management of Mind Id and PLN was an oddity in the technical aspects of the Odin Project.

Due diligence carried out by Ricardo, an IBC consultant for technical aspects, one of which found that there was a discontinuation of the supply of steering gear to StreetScooter, so it was necessary to find a new supplier that had to be tested, validated, and re-certified.

Dany Amrul Ichdan, the only former director of Mind Id who was not removed, said that all the risks and mitigations found by the consultant had been included in the discounting factor in the due diligence calculation and became the basis for the acquisition decision.
